The image captures a modern, well-lit interior corridor, strongly suggesting a subway or metro station in Koridallos, Greece. The perspective looks down a long passageway, characterized by clean, reflective surfaces. On the left, a prominent wall is rendered in a deep red or maroon hue, featuring numerous circular cut-outs or integrated light fixtures that cast bright white light. This polished wall reflects the environment, including elements from the opposite side of the corridor. The floor is made of light-colored, reflective tiles, mirroring the artificial illumination and contributing to the bright atmosphere. A tactile paving strip, consisting of parallel red lines, runs along the right side of the floor, extending into the distance, indicating accessibility features for the visually impaired. In the upper right corner of the image, a blue cleaning cart with a metal handle is visible, implying ongoing maintenance or recent cleaning of the premises, though no people are present in the frame. At the far end of the corridor, a brightly lit opening leads to another section where some white seating or benches can be vaguely seen. Adjacent to this opening, on the wall, are a few small square signs, one resembling a "no smoking" symbol, and a white vertical directional sign with a black upward-pointing arrow. The text on this sign, partially obscured and in Greek, appears to indicate a destination or facility, possibly "Σταθμός" (Station). The scene is marked by its pristine condition and the orderly arrangement of architectural elements, suggesting a quiet moment within a bustling public transport hub.
